Ho installato uno script jQuery "slideDown", tutto funziona normalmente ma vorrei che il mio div scomparisse quando clicco fuori o quando clicco su un altro pulsante. Mi potete aiutare per favore ?
La mia sceneggiatura:
<script type="text/javascript">
$( "button1" ).click(function() {
$( "#divacacher1" ).toggle( "slow" );
});
$( "button2" ).click(function() {
$( "#divacacher2" ).toggle( "slow" );
});
...
</script>
Il mio HTML:
<button1>EN SAVOIR PLUS</button1>
<div id="divacacher1" style="display: none;">
<div class="blockRight">
...
</div>
</div>
risposte:
0 per risposta № 1Prova questo
$( "button1" ).click(function() {
$( "#divacacher1" ).toggle( "slow" );
$("body").click(function() {
$("#divacher1").toggle();
});
});